Output 96e420716068b58e3b84db5c8f534b202255bb414f044319cfffedca6e1ec00a:72

value
22288
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 b7512e9d0776779c5a7fc66df0b311666c02101a OP_EQUALVERIFY OP_CHECKSIG
address
1HiHujdcJzWfFSWZF26Qusj52MBVRW5T1C
transaction
96e420716068b58e3b84db5c8f534b202255bb414f044319cfffedca6e1ec00a
confirmations
200903
spent
true